サーチ…


Meteorアプリケーション用のElectrifyのインストール

電子ポートHTML Webアプリケーションを、ネイティブデスクトップアプリケーションの作成を含むさまざまなデバイスのネイティブアプリケーションに移植します。また、始めるのもとても簡単です!

まず、 electronnodejsnpmgitmeteorインストールされている必要があります。これらのツールに精通していることは、Meteorを操作する上で不可欠なので、まずこれらのことを知っておいてください。


電子

npm install -g electrify
  • electronは私たちが使っているものです!詳細はこちらをご覧ください
  • electrifyはMeteorアプリケーションをパッケージ化するためのツールです。 ここでモードを読み取ります。

Electrify with Meteorのインストールおよび使用に関するその他の要件

流星

curl https://install.meteor.com/ | sh

Meteorをインストールする方法はたくさんありますこちらをご覧ください

  • meteorは、アプリケーションを構築するために使用するJavaScriptフレームワークです。これは、Webアプリケーションでは概念的に難しい問題のいくつかについて、多くのコーディングの単純化を提供します。そのシンプルさはプロトタイプのプロジェクトに役立つと言われています。詳細はこちらをご覧ください

NodeJS

apt-get install nodejs build-essentials

お使いのOSによっては、インストールする方法がたくさんあります。 ここであなたが必要な方法を見つけてください

  • nodejsはNode.jsのパッケージで、サーバーサイドでJavaScriptを実行するためのJavascript環境です。詳細はこちらをご覧ください

npm

npmnodejsインストールにバンドルする必要があります。 nodejsインストール後にnpm -vコマンドを実行して確認します。

  • npmはNode Package Managerです。これは、ノードプロジェクトに簡単に追加できるオープンソースモジュールの巨大なコレクションです。詳細はこちらをご覧ください

メテオのアプリケーションで電化を使用する

Linuxシェル(コマンドライン)スクリプトを使ってMeteor Todosのサンプルプロジェクトをダウンロードして、プロジェクトを初めて検証してみましょう。


このセクションの要件:

Git

apt-get install git-all

Gitをインストールする方法はたくさんあります。 ここでそれらをチェックしてください

  • gitはファイルのバージョン管理システムです。公開リポジトリ(GitHubは有名なリポジトリ)やプライベートリポジトリ(BitBucketは限定的な無料プライベートリポジトリを提供しています)にリモートで(すなわちオンラインで)保存することができます。もっと読む[ここ] [5]。

#!/usr/bin/bash

# Change this parameter to choose where to clone the repository to.
TODOSPATH="/home/user/development/meteor-todos"

# Download the repository to the $TODOSPATH location.
git clone https://github.com/meteor/todos.git "$TODOSPATH"

# Change directory (`cd`) into the Todos project folder.
cd "$TODOSPATH"

TODOSPATHパラメータで指定された場所に 'meteor-todos'というプロジェクトフォルダが作成されます。ディレクトリ( cd )をプロジェクトフォルダに変更しましたので、このプロジェクトにElectrifyを追加しましょう!

# It's really this simple.
electrify

それは正しい - 単一の単語のコマンド、そして私たちのプロジェクトは準備が整いました。コマンドとしてelectrifyを実行しようとすると、権限が無効になる可能性があります。その場合は、権限を無効にするためにsudo electrifyを試してみてください。

しかし、これらのアクセス権の問題を解決しようとしてください。不必要にsudoするのは良い方法ではありません(これについては詳しく説明しますが、それはなぜですか?



Modified text is an extract of the original Stack Overflow Documentation
ライセンスを受けた CC BY-SA 3.0
所属していない Stack Overflow